Friday Finds: Revere Pewter HC-172

The most-searched-for color on the Hirshfield’s blog is the Benjamin Moore color revere pewter HC-172. Which makes perfect sense, because that is the most-searched-for color on Benjamin Moore’s site. What makes it so popular? A light gray with warm undertones, revere pewter (HC-172) is a great transitional color that works equally well on walls, ceilings,...
